About the event:

There will be a coffee morning being held for Ovarian Cancer Awareness Month on The Research Floor (Level 5) in St Mary’s Hospital. There will be coffee, tea and cakes and a chance to donate what you wish to the Emma Gyles Bursary Fund.

Money raised by the Emma Gyles Bursary Fund is used to fund a bursary that supports a medical student at the University of Manchester to allow them to take a year out from their studies to carry out research into ovarian cancer with Prof. Richard Edmondson.
